Stroll through the treetops from one part of the village to the other.
The ‘Senda dil Dragun’, the world’s longest treetop walkway, does more than connect the two districts of Laax Murschetg and Laax village. The 1.56-kilometre-long footbridge offers visitors, young and old alike, the opportunity to experience the Laax forest at eye level with the trees, while also enjoying the peace and quiet. With five adventure points on a tower, four platforms with seating and several marble run installations, the Graubünden treetop walkway is an interactive and unique nature experience for the whole family, in both summer and winter.
